How MoCA Supports Detecting Alzheimer’s, Parkinson’s, and Neurological Changes
Cognitive health is one of the most critical aspects of overall well-being, yet it is often overlooked until problems become more apparent. The Montreal Cognitive Assessment has emerged as a powerful tool in identifying early signs of cognitive decline, helping clinicians, patients, and families take timely action. This assessment evaluates multiple areas of cognition and provides a comprehensive snapshot of brain function, making it invaluable in detecting conditions like Alzheimer’s disease, Parkinson’s disease, and other neurological changes.
How MoCA Detects Early Signs of Alzheimer’s Disease
Alzheimer’s disease is the most common form of dementia, affecting millions worldwide. Early symptoms often include memory lapses, difficulty recalling names, or challenges with planning and organizing. While these signs can be subtle, the MoCA is sensitive enough to identify early deficits before they escalate.
Detecting Parkinson’s-Related Cognitive Changes
While Parkinson’s disease is often associated with motor symptoms, such as tremors and stiffness, cognitive changes are also common, especially as the disease progresses. Problems with attention, executive function, and visuospatial skills can impact daily living, including tasks like managing finances or navigating familiar environments.
Recognizing Other Neurological Changes
Beyond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s, cognitive decline can be associated with a range of neurological conditions, including:
- Vascular dementia: Often caused by small strokes or blood vessel changes in the brain.
- Traumatic brain injury: Subtle cognitive effects can persist long after the injury.
- Multiple sclerosis: Cognitive symptoms such as memory and attention deficits can affect daily functioning.
- Other neurodegenerative diseases: Including Lewy body dementia and frontotemporal dementia.
MoCA’s comprehensive design allows for early detection of these conditions as well. By comparing scores across domains and over time, clinicians can identify patterns that indicate neurological changes, prompting further evaluation or interventions.

Understanding Medical Director Requirements for Arizona Med Spas
It is not just about treatments and technology to open or run a med spa in Arizona. It is also concerning medical control. Being a qualified medical director is one of the most significant legal and safety requirements.
The role of a medical director remains a mystery to many med spa owners, and people are confused as to why this position should be so significant. This guide is given straightforwardly and understandably.
What Is a Medical Director in Arizona?
The type of medical supervision in Arizona is a med spa in which a licensed physician is available to offer medical supervision. Given that most aesthetic treatments are medical treatments, state laws dictate the need to have a doctor supervising them.
Although the owner of the med spa is not necessarily a doctor, medical supervision is necessary. It is at this point that a medical director of a med spa will be necessary.
Why Arizona Med Spas Need a Medical Director
The Arizona legislation regards such medical procedures as injectables, laser procedures, and high-tech skin treatment. Due to this reason, such services have to be under the supervision of a physician.
With the assistance of a medical director, it is ensured that:
- Treatment is carried out safely.
- Employees adhere to health care practices.
- The spa is established under Arizona guidelines.
Key Responsibilities of a Medical Director
A medical director is not a title in paper. There are a number of significant responsibilities that they have.
1. Medical Oversight
The medical director is in charge of all the medical services provided in the spa. This involves the acceptance of treatment procedures, and their compliance with safety standards.
2. Staff Supervision
Nurses, injectors, and other medical workers report to the medical director. The director makes sure that they are well-trained and qualified.
3. Patient Safety
The most important thing is patient safety. The medical director assists in the minimization of risks, as well as the suitability of treatments to a particular patient.
4. Adherence to Arizona laws.
Rules can change over time. A medical director assists the spa to remain in line with the existing medical and legal standards.
Medical Director Aesthetics: Why Experience Matters
All doctors are adept in aesthetic medicine. The importance of the medical director’s aesthetic experience is that cosmetic treatments need special knowledge.
An aesthetic medical director realizes:
- Cosmetic injectables
- Skin treatments
- Laser safety
- Patient expectations
It is this kind of knowledge that assists the med spa in providing safe and natural-looking outcomes.
Who Can Be a Medical Director in Arizona?
An Arizona medical director should:
- Have a state physician license (MD or DO)
- Have an active Arizona medical license.
- Know aesthetic or cosmetic medicine.
Depending on the agreement, some medical directors serve one spa only, whereas others work in different locations.

The Benefits of In-Home ABA Therapy for Children and Families
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) therapy is well-known and scientifically supported behavioral therapy that assists children in learning valuable skills and desirable behaviors. Although ABA therapy can be administered either in a therapy center, school, or community, in-home ABA therapy has become an increasingly popular alternative for many families. In-home ABA therapy provides a diverse range of advantages through the delivery of therapy within a child’s natural setting.
This piece will discuss the major advantages of home-based ABA therapy in Maryland and why it can be a great effective option for you and your family.
What Is In-Home ABA Therapy?
In-home ABA therapy requires that an individualized structured therapy session be conducted for the child at home. A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) usually sets up this programming; however, registered behavior technicians (RBTs) or ABA therapists implement it.
The therapy aims to improve communication skills, social interactions, daily living skills, learning readiness, and positive behaviors within the very context where the child spends most of their time.
1. Learning within a Familiar and Comfortable Setting
One of the main advantages of in-home ABA therapy is that it provides the child with therapy in an environment they are familiar with. Home is the most comforting and safest place for the child, and it helps the child relax and cooperate during the therapy process.
If children feel at ease, they might find it easier to learn. The fact that therapists work with reality, everyday activities, and items in the world can make learning more significant, hence easier to grasp.
2. Development of Real Life Skills
In-home ABA therapy also helps therapists teach the children applicable skills within their day-to-day lives. Rather than teaching skills within a pretend environment, children can practice them within the context where they happen.
Examples include:
- Taking care of normal daily activities, like brushing teeth or getting dressed
- Enhancing Communication in Meal Times and Play Sessions
- Learning proper behavior when interacting with families
- Achieving Independence in Personal Care and Household Activities
Since these skills are being practiced within real-life situations, it is likely that the children apply these skills effectively on their own.
3. Therapy on an Individualized and Personalized Basis
Every child has different strengths, challenges, and learning styles. In-home ABA therapy is highly specialized, with treatment plans tailored specifically to the child’s needs and home environment.
Therapists can adapt strategies according to:
- The daily routine of the child
- Family Routines and Priorities
- The physical structure of the home
- Cultural values and preferences
This amount of tailoring helps to ensure that therapy goals are realistic and relevant and that they align with the lifestyle of the family.
4. Strong Family Involvement and Support
In-home ABA therapy also promotes the involvement of the family, an aspect that is crucial to the long-term success of the process. This allows caregivers to observe the sessions and obtain information directly from the therapists.
It engages the community in the following ways:
- Learn how therapy approaches work
- Reinforcement of favorable behaviors between sessions
- Ensure consistency among varied circumstances
- Feel more confident in supporting his/her development
Whether or not it is possible to continue progress outside of therapy sessions is contingent on actively engaging family members.
5. Improved Consistency and Generalization
One of the challenges in building skills is to ensure that behaviors learned are transferred from the training area to habitual performances in everyday life. In-home ABA therapy eliminates this challenge since it is conducted in the home, where it is easy to reinforce what has been learned in everyday activities.
For instance, if the child is able to respond to instructions in the house, they can be able to perform the same activity all day long. This is an example of applying what the child has learned in order to make progress.
